Kepong Church given 14 days to move out or face demolition


Committee of the Chinese Methodist Church Kepong showing the building plans they submitted to DBKL for land conversion exercise, as well the two eviction notices they received.

KUALA LUMPUR: The Chinese Methodist Church Kepong has been slapped with a second eviction notice from the Kuala Lumpur City Hall (DBKL), and have been given 14 days to move out or "face demolition".

The notices dated Sep 19, 2013 and Feb 4 this year stated that the church, located in Taman Sri Bintang, had violated Section 26 of the Federal Territories (Planning) Act 1982 for changing the land use from institutional centres (kindergarten) and to places of worship (church) without a Development Order.
